Hi all — quick note from the front desk at Averlane House. The basement archive room (B-03) is back in use after the damp works, so expect pickup requests again. Anyone heading down needs to sign the ledger at the desk first, and please don't prop the fire door — it sets off the Penhallow alarm panel and I get the call. Lighting is on a ten-minute timer, switch is on the right. To get into B-03 itself, key in the code below.

door code, yagap-bahof: bdg-O-05

14:22 — Scaling math in Ladleworks calculator started returning zeroed yields for fractional servings. 14:30 — Paged; traced to a rounding helper shipped in the morning deploy. 14:41 — Rolled back to previous image; yields correct on canary. 14:55 — Confirmed no persisted recipes corrupted; cache flushed. Follow-up: add unit tests for sub-1 multipliers. The rollback artifact on-call should pin in the deploy manifest is referenced by the token below.

trace token, kahog-tajeg: htk6_97d963

Calendar sync conflicts in Tidewell

When a customer's Tidewell calendar shows duplicate events, it usually means two sync sources claimed the same series. Ask which connector they added most recently, then disable it and run a re-merge from the admin panel. If the re-merge tool asks you to confirm destructive changes, authenticate with the recovery passphrase shown below.

strongbox words: prawyn-fenmir

Management Meeting Minutes — Budget Request, Orvane Retail Group. Present: Tilda, Marcus, Jo. Tilda walked us through the sales enablement ask: 220k for the Brightfell demo kit refresh and two regional workshops. Marcus pushed back on travel costs; we trimmed 15%. Jo will recirculate the revised numbers Friday. Overall mood: supportive, assuming Q2 pipeline holds. Before acting on any of this, sales leads should read the note below.

management briefing: Project Ulavan slips by two quarters because of the staffing delay.